This was my favorite part of the care package. I hope it works well!! It is a disposable digital camcorder. It's from CVS Pharmacy. It holds 20 minutes of video and then they will develop it and put it on DVD with software for sharing!
It's $30 which I wouldn't normally spend but it's way worth it to get a video from China of our baby. She might be able to get a video of my friend's baby there too. So that would be awesome. Just wanted to share for those of you who have waiting kiddos where this might come in handy.
